Pamela M. Duke, MD is a Professor of Medicine in the Division of Internal Medicine at Drexel University College of Medicine. She serves as course director for Clinical Skills, Third Year Professional Formation, and the Primary Care Practicum. Her academic background includes an MD from the University of Connecticut School of Medicine and a BA from Swarthmore College, with fellowships in Healthcare Communication and Geriatrics. Dr. Duke is board certified in internal medicine and focuses on patient communication, geriatric care, chronic disease management, and medical education innovation. She has authored a pathophysiology textbook and co-authored influential articles on clinical communication and medical professionalism.
Notable recognitions include multiple Golden Apple Awards (2023-2025) for teaching excellence and repeated inclusion in Philadelphia magazine's Top Doctors list (2024-2025). Her research integrates technology-enhanced learning methods, such as virtual group discussions for empathy preservation in medical students, and EHR integration strategies. Dr. Duke actively contributes to healthcare communication workshops and serves on the American Academy of Healthcare Communication.
